iPadOS 26.4 Final Version Released Alongside visionOS 26.4, tvOS 26.4, watchOS 26.4, macOS 26.4

Apple has today released new versions of the software that powers its devices, including the iPhone. Apple device owners can now download the final version of iPadOS 26.4 alongside visionOS 26.4, tvOS 26.4, watchOS 26.4, and macOS 26.4.

All of these updates are now available as free downloads for those with compatible devices, and we recommend installing the updates to ensure you have the latest bug and security fixes.

In terms of new features, however, these releases bring a few new features to the table. We still expect a few more updates before Apple unveils iOS 27 at WWDC in June, and that’s when the big new additions will come to Apple’s platforms.

iPadOS 26.4

The new iPadOS 26.4 update can be download via the Settings app and brings with it a few new features. Apple Music adds a new Apple Intelligence feature that can create a playlist from a user’s description, for example. Eight new emoji are also added to the mix, among other improvements.

macOS 26.4, watchOS 26.4, visionOS 26.4, and tvOS 26.4

Apple Mac, Apple Watch, Apple Vision Pro, and Apple TV updates are also now available for download by the public. You can get these updates via the usual mechanism, whether that’s the System Settings app on the Mac, the Watch app on the iPhone for the Apple Watch, or the Settings app elsewhere.
